Transaction 23fb66119bd92c8f2e91b3915878568493fd5f6bf49e2a71a7066e2eeafd5db0
1 Input
1 Output
-
23fb66119bd92c8f2e91b3915878568493fd5f6bf49e2a71a7066e2eeafd5db0:0
- value
- 831366
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b45900d09dc0a33df337d713ee10c3d360d95360 OP_EQUAL
- address
- 3J8cB85Q86BnSZaXHGHWboMQcxezJZKFf9